What is a Casino Online?

A casino online is an internet-based virtual gambling platform that allows users to access a range of different casino games. These include slots, table games, and live dealer tables. Online casinos are becoming increasingly popular, as they offer many of the same benefits as their land-based counterparts. In addition, they can be accessed from almost any location with an internet connection.

To play casino online, players must first create an account with the site. This typically involves providing personal details and a username/password. Then, they can deposit funds into their account using a variety of banking options. Once they have sufficient funds, they can begin playing their favorite casino games.

While most online casinos accept major credit cards, some also support e-wallets such as PayPal and Skrill. These methods may incur transaction fees, but they are still convenient. Furthermore, some online casinos even offer cashback bonuses based on their customers’ losses.

Another advantage of online casinos is their security features. Most reputable sites will feature games that have been tested by independent auditors to ensure they provide fair results. They also uphold responsible gambling and player protection policies, making them a safe and reliable option for players of all skill levels.

Choosing the best casino online for your needs depends on your preferences and budget. Some online casinos are better for high-rollers, while others cater to casual players. Some have extensive sports betting markets, while others focus on classic casino games like blackjack and roulette.
